The excitement from the NBA season opener featuring the Warriors and Lakers is electric. The hosts analyze the Lakers' struggles without LeBron and Jonathan Kuminga's impressive performance. OKC's thrilling double overtime win over the Rockets draws attention, spotlighting Chet Holmgren's impact. The discussion also dives into Michael Jordan's candid insights during his NBC segment, with thoughts on how he can reshape basketball commentary. Tension rises as they explore Kevin Durant's minutes and his complicated legacy in Oklahoma City.

ANECDOTE

Home Opener Reunion And A Moving Visit

  • Howard Beck described returning to the Lakers home opener for the first time since 2003 and reconnecting with old colleagues and memories.
  • He stopped to visit Bill Plaschke, who wrote about boxing to manage Parkinson's, and found the moment especially moving.
INSIGHT

Luka-Centric Roster Reveals Structural Flaws

  • The Lakers' offense collapses when Luka Dončić is off the floor and their defense struggles when he is on it, exposing roster limitations.
  • Howard Beck and Logan Murdoch warned that recent offseason additions don't solve the Lakers' structural playmaking and defensive problems.
INSIGHT

Kuminga's Performance Boosts Trade And Roster Value

  • Jonathan Kuminga showed promising growth with efficient shooting, playmaking, and improved decision-making in the Warriors' opener.
  • Howard Beck noted the Warriors see him as an asset whether to keep or trade depending on his continued development.
